Understanding Gout

Gout occurs when urate crystals accumulate in your joint, causing the inflammation and intense pain of a gout attack. Urate crystals can form when you have high levels of uric acid in your blood. Your body produces uric acid when it breaks down purines — substances that are naturally found in your body as well as in many foods. When your body either produces too much uric acid or your kidneys excrete too little, uric acid can build up, forming sharp, needle-like crystals in a joint or surrounding tissue that cause pain, inflammation, and swelling.

The Science of Cold Therapy

Cold therapy, also known as cryotherapy, has long been used in the medical field to treat various conditions, including injuries, inflammation, and pain. When cold is applied to an affected area, it causes the blood vessels to constrict, reducing blood flow to the area. This vasoconstriction helps to decrease swelling and inflammation by limiting the amount of fluid that can accumulate in the tissues. Additionally, cold therapy can numb the nerve endings, providing temporary pain relief.

Can a Cold Therapy Ice Machine be Used for Gout Pain?

The answer is yes. Cold therapy can be an effective way to manage the pain and inflammation associated with gout attacks. Applying cold to the affected joint can help to reduce swelling, numb the pain, and provide a sense of relief. Benefits of Using a Cold Therapy Ice Machine for Gout

  1. Reduced Inflammation: As mentioned earlier, cold therapy causes vasoconstriction, which helps to reduce inflammation in the affected joint. By limiting the blood flow to the area, the Cold Therapy Ice Machine can prevent the buildup of fluid and reduce swelling.
  2. Pain Relief: The cold temperature can numb the nerve endings in the joint, providing temporary pain relief. This can be especially helpful during a gout attack when the pain can be excruciating.
  3. Improved Mobility: By reducing swelling and pain, cold therapy can help to improve mobility in the affected joint. This can allow patients to move more freely and perform their daily activities with less discomfort.
